I had the same problem with

fsck.vfat -a /dev/sde6

I was backup my hard disk with my mp3 collection, the parition is about
55 gb and it was almost full. rysnc threw up lot of I/O errors and so i
did a fsck.

fsck.vfat -a /dev/sde6

After the fsck there were numberous fsck####.rec files. Those files were
recovered but put in the top hierarchy of the drive and not in the
subfolder from where they came. But since the names are changed, how can
I put them back the original folders.

There are numerous files and numerous subfolders and also number .rec
files, so renaming them and putting back would be a big problem. Is this
Ubuntu specific or dosfstools specific ?

I am ready to supply more information  if needed.
